DETERMINATION OF LSORBOSE PREPARED BY BIOCONVERSIONAND RESIDUAL DSORBITOL IN IT BY DERIVATIVE

Article Abstract by: TsingHua    

Original Author: ACTA PHARMACEUTICA SINICA
A derivative GC method with ntetracosane as the internal standard was developed for the determination of Lsorbose prepared
by bioconversion and residual Dsorbitol in it. The method includes two procedures. The first procedure involves acetylation of bioconversion samples with a solution of acetic anhydride: pyridine(1∶1) at 90℃ for 20 min. The resulting products were assayed by GC to determine residual Dsorbitol. The second procedure involves reduction of the bioconversion samples with NaBH4 in aqueous solution at 40℃ for 1 hour followed by reaction with the mixture of acetic anhydride: pyridine(1∶1) at 90℃ for 20 min. The resulting products were assayed by GC to determine Lsorbose. Chromatography was performed on a 5% OV17 stainless steel column(2 m×3 mm ID) with nitrogen as carrier gas. The detector was FID. The standard curves of Dsorbitol and Lsorbose were linear in the ranges of 001999~2999 μg and 4000~24000 μg respectively. The method has been applied to assay Lsorbose and residual Dsorbitol in bioconversion products and to monitor bioconversion termination point of Lsorbose.
